This is a good article, in that most important info is presented; i.e. what are the skills sets and experiences of these two players.
Obviously, Shiancoe is a potential starter, while Ciurciu and Wade are backups, unless the Vikings use a slot receiver often in 2007.
The following quote hints at why rebuilding a team takes a few years...
" ..... Obviously I had some experience with him in the last three years and then this happened to be a contract year for him."
..... "
-
Childress, on the reason for signing Shiancoe
The players that a coach wants on his roster are not always immediately available because the average length of a contract is 3-4 years.
So, a few years will pass
before a coach can add all the (role) players he wants ( without taking the more expensive route of trading ) when their contracts expire.
Trades are used less often during rebuilding because a team has to give up 'equal value' to acquire a player to fill an area of need.
That usually means a surplus of player value exists in another position, e.g. RB, which rarely occurs during rebuilding.
